Once Your site is speedy and runs easily on all the things from telephones to desktops, search engines give you a Improve in rankings. These technical tools allow you to discover and fix the concealed troubles that could be holding your site again. It’s a 0-a hundred score determined by https://seotoolscenters.com/
The Basic Principles Of Seo tools
Internet - 2 hours 18 minutes ago edmundf148kor9Web Directory Categories
Web Directory Search
New Site Listings